Phuket gunning for six million visitors



PHUKET is expected to attract six million visitors this year, up from 2009’s 5.5 million, according to the Tourism Authority of Thailand (TAT).
TAT Phuket office director Bangornrat Shinaprayoon said the forecast was based on the southern Thailand beach destination's monthly year-on-year growth of 20 to 30 per cent from January to May.
Foreign visitor numbers are projected to reach 4.5 million, an increase over last year's four million. Australia, the UK, Sweden, South Korea and Germany were Phuket's top five markets in 2009.
Bangornrat said Russia was poised to overtake Germany this year as the island's fifth largest source market.
Meanwhile, the growing number of direct regional flights is expected to bring in even more visitors from Australia, India, the Middle East and South Korea.
